Made sure all permission was given … high waisted khaki shorts forever 21WebTo establish wireless Android Auto™ connection: Make sure that your Android™ Phone has Bluetooth® ON. On the vehicle’s multimedia screen select Settings (gear icon) > ‘Bluetooth® & devices’ > ‘Add another device’ > ‘Search for devices’. Select your phone’s name as it appears on list of discovered Bluetooth® devices. how many feet per psiWebAug 31, 2024 · Enable Android Auto in Gladiator. Android Auto must be enabled in your Gladiator’s infotainment system settings if you want it to launch automatically when you connect USB. To enable Android Auto, select Apps, then Projection Manager. Check the box next to Smartphone Device Mirroring.
